Yes Liam said the blue/uv bars are a great compliment to the 14k Meridian. Basically when you add the blue from the bar you get everything they took out of the original to create the “shallow reef” back (they’re officially calling it shallow reef from this point forward 14k was just the first name they came up with). The new shallow reef color and the blue uv bars seems like it offers the best of all worlds for the most adjustability. You can choose crazy fluorescence and non visible uv along with tuning the whites from cool to warm exactly how you want. He seemed very excited about the possibilities with this new combination.

The bundle with the new shallow reef meridian is now available on the website. Just placed my order with what Liam suggested (shallow + UV/blue). One reason he gave me is that the UV and white are on the same channel on the 14K bar, so you can't raise the UV without the white.

I have the Edge bars mounted front and back of my two Kessils. You can't see the glare from the Edge bars, but you most definitely can from the Kessils. The lens of the Kessils hangs down outside of the housing which causes a terrible glare unless you have the light shades. The Edge and Meridian LEDs are set behind the glass so you don't have the glare issue

Ordered the manual controls, and both the BOT and the side mounts.
One of the best decisions I made with regard to the order was getting the manual control feature. Once I get more acquainted with the fixure I will play with the app.
Currently using the side mounts, but I am going to change over to the BOT. I think the light needs to be higher secondary to shading on the ends.
There is no light spillage, the shimmer is not overwhelming. Currently I am only running the fixture at 25%.
I have been only running the fixture for 3 days but my zoanthids look noticeably better already.
I will be adding the 14k blade soon.
My tank is the IM 25 lagoon.
